Scope
This document presents an introduction and overview of mass properties control for commercial and military vehicle systems. This document addresses the top level considerations for Mass Properties Engineering (MPE) in the aerospace, marine, and ground vehicle industries and other allied industries. As with all Society of Allied Weight Engineers (SAWE) products, this document was produced by volunteers from government and industry.
Purpose
The purpose of this document is to provide an overview of Mass Properties Engineering (MPE) and its control and management processes, discuss its importance and cost benefits, introduce the Society of Allied Weight Engineers (SAWE), and provide a listing of resources that provide educational information to managers as well as novice and experienced mass properties engineers.
